Job description
Role

To provide support to individuals to help them find work, and signpost them to other local agencies/organisations as appropriate, i.e. DWP, CAB etc.

Responsibilities
  • Establish what support is required to help client seek and gain employment
  • Help clients create an email account and Universal Jobmatch account
  • Advise on and edit client CVs and help clients to fill out job application forms, both online and paper-based
  • Provide one-to-one support with computer use
  • Conduct mock-interviews with clients
  • Signpost clients to other agencies as required
  • Undertake administrative tasks as appropriate
Person Specification
  • Interest in Salvation Army’s work
  • Ability to keep confidences
  • Good listening and empathy skills
  • Reliable and regular commitment to our drop-in sessions
  • Understanding of Universal Jobmatch website would be advantageous, although not essential as training can be given
  • Confident using the internet, Microsoft Office and google documents
  • Computer literate and basic knowledge of setting up computer equipment
  • Commitment to safeguarding and protecting vulnerable adults and a willingness to raise concerns where necessary
  • Ability to keep confidences and be sensitive to peoples’ circumstances
Time commitment

The time commitment is 3hrs per week and will be agreed with the Community Programme Coordinator, but we can be flexible to meet your circumstances. Shift pattern 10am-1pm or 1pm-4pm Monday to Saturday.

Training & Support

The Salvation Army provides an induction/basic volunteer training via I-Learn portal or at a training day as well as ongoing training as required. We also offer ‘taster’ sessions to see if our volunteer role is a good fit for your skills, experience and interests.

Volunteer expenses

The role is unpaid, but reasonable expenses incurred can be paid with prior agreement of the Community Manager.
